A Brief History of Westminster Christian Assembly
(Compiled in November, 1999)
Sometime prior to 1961, Jack and Lois Peters, former members of Immanuel Christian Assembly (ICA), in Los Angeles, California, contacted ICA and suggested that they consider establishing an independent Fellowship of Christian Assemblies church in the rapidly growing suburbs of Orange County, California. Rev. Paul Zettersten, then pastor of ICA, was responsible for initiating the founding of Westminster Christian Assembly (WCA), in Westminster, California.
In 1961 David and Edith Bakken were called to pastor a small group of people who gathered in a converted home on Bolsa Street, west of Newland Street, in Midway City. On June 28, 1964, ICA authorized the purchase of the present location of WCA, a former turkey ranch consisting of a residence and a utility building on ¾ acres, for $42,000. Ground was broken for the sanctuary on May 21, 1967, with the chapel (currently the fellowship hall) being dedicated on November 14, 1968. Pastor Bakken resigned in the summer of 1971.
In 1971, Richard and Ellen Carlson became the pastors of WCA. Under their leadership WCA grew from nine people to an average of two hundred seventy six by 1980. In addition, a new facility was built and dedicated on November 18, 1979. During this time WCA became active in missions work in Honduras. Pastor Carlson resigned in 1983 to pioneer a new church in Palm Desert, California.
Dan and Karen Fick (Dick and Ellen Carlson’s daughter and son-in-law, and former associate pastors) became the senior pastors in 1983 and served until May of 1987. A dramatic change in the surrounding community led to a gradual decline in attendance. However WCA remained an active church—especially in their missions work in Honduras.
Ed and Marilyn Toews assumed pastoral leadership in June of 1987 and served until 1989.
Bob and Laverne Emerson then became WCA pastors in 1989 and served until the summer of 1997.
Following Bob Emerson’s resignation, WCA began a search for a senior pastor. In the interim, Clifford and Jan Larson served as pastors from the summer of 1997 until April, 1998.
After serving Garden Grove First Assembly of God for twelve years, Ken and Susan Schoening were called to serve as pastors of WCA in April of 1998.
In September of 2015 former AG Missionary to Greece Jean Morgan was called to serve as Pastor of WCA.
